Energy storage systems typically involve the integration of batteries, inverters, controllers, and other electrical components. Junction boxes help manage these connections in a way that ensures safety, optimizes system performance, and allows for easy maintenance and upgrades. A junction box for solar panels is a key component that functions as the central hub of electrical connections of the solar cells. Using a junction box for a photovoltaic system ensures the safe and efficient transfer of electricity generated by the solar panels to the rest of the system. It serves as the panel's “nerve center,” connecting the solar cells to the external cables that transmit electricity. A solar combiner box is an electrical enclosure that consolidates multiple solar panel strings into a single power source before connecting to the inverter.
